A true rarity from a region where quality coffee is being revived. We are proud to present a coffee produced by the Dawoodi Bohras community of Yemen. Evaluated according to the SCA and CQI standard, it received an 84 SCA from us during cupping in Europe (EU SPOT), and the gradation of green coffee defects is an impressive 0/3.

 

A natural processed coffee, we note in the sensory description: apricot, raspberry, green apple, milk chocolate, black cherry, citrus, flowers hints, the body of the coffee is in the direction of round, slightly sparkling, aroma you can describe as also strawberry-like, tea-like,  it’s a sweet coffee.

„Yemen’s East Haraaz region, once celebrated for its thriving coffee cultivation, saw a drastic decline due to the rise of Qaat, a cash crop that drained the soil and diminished the agricultural landscape. However, the tide has turned. In 1961, His Holiness Dr. Syedna Mohammed Burhanuddin RA began a movement to restore Yemen’s coffee industry, urging farmers to uproot Qaat and revive coffee cultivation. Under the leadership of His Holiness Dr. Syedna Mufaddal Saifuddin TUS, the effort to plant coffee has grown significantly. Between 2019 and 2022, over 350,000 coffee saplings were planted, marking a new era of prosperity for the region.

 

The Upliftment Office, established to oversee this transformation, plays a vital role in guiding farmers. It provides essential resources such as irrigation systems, tools, and technical support for cultivating high-quality coffee. The transition from Qaat to coffee farming has not only improved the region’s soil health but has also created a sustainable future for its farmers.

 

The launch of Aqeeq Haraz Bunn represents a new chapter in this journey. As Yemen’s coffee production blooms again, this brand helps empower local farmers by providing them with a platform to sell their high-quality beans at fair prices. The office’s initiative to purchase coffee directly from farmers at competitive rates ensures that they are financially supported, fostering growth in the coffee industry. Today, over 90% of East Haraaz is free from Qaat, and the farmers are thriving thanks to the focus on coffee and fruit tree cultivation.

 

With coffee becoming a key business for the farmers of East Haraaz, companies like Haraaz Coffee, Mocha Mountains, and Haraz Mocha are thriving, thanks to the support of the Upliftment Office.
